Ti Kaye was the perfect spot for our honeymoon. For an unbelievably reasonably rate, we had a beautiful, private villa right on a cliff looking out over the Caribbean Sea with a private plunge pool (and air conditioning!) The outdoor shower was gorgeous, like showing in a tropical garden, and the staff even spelled out "Welcome" in flower petals on the bed when we arrived. I couldn't have asked for anything more. The restaurant was unique, beautiful (mostly outdoors, though covered) and had excellent local cuisine and a constantly changing menu.
You do have to be able to climb the 160-or-so steps down to the beach and back up, and the beach gets invaded by tourists on local catamaran tours in the afternoons - but we went to the beach in the morning when it was empty and relaxed in our hammock, our plunge pool, or the main pool (or by the bar!) during the afternoons.
If you tend to get motion sick, don't plan outings outside of the hotel because the island is very hilly and the car rides are rough, but we had a great time snorkeling at the hotel, taking a sunset sail which left from the hotel, and relaxing.
It was perfect!
